Handover note — Crumbwheel order cutoffs.

Welcome aboard. The bakery cutoff rule in Crumbwheel closes same-day orders at 14:00 local to each storefront, not UTC — this has bitten us twice. Holiday overrides live in the calendar service and take precedence silently, so always check there first when a cutoff looks wrong. To unlock the calendar service's admin console after a restart, enter the recovery passphrase below.

vault phrase of bagap-bahaf = silion-pelox-sorox-casdor-quenwyn-fraax-eliox-praael-kelion-quenvan-kasox-rusael-norius-belvan

Ticket: ScrubJay vault sealed — blocking EXIF pipeline

For weekly sync: the metadata-scrubbing service can't fetch its keys; vault sealed after the Hollick node reboot. EXIF stripping is paused, uploads queuing. Fix is a manual unseal, then restart workers. Owner: Priya's team. The recovery passphrase needed for the unseal follows.

vault phrase of bagaf-kajeg = jorath-feniel-briir-siliel-ralix

**Ticket: Snapshot vault locked — UI component baselines inaccessible**

The Brambleview snapshot-testing vault locked itself after three failed sync attempts, so baseline images for the UI component suite can't be updated. Future maintainers: regenerating snapshots requires unlocking the vault first via the CLI's restore flow. Delete the stale lockfile, rerun the unlock command, and when prompted supply the passphrase listed immediately below.

vault phrase of tajeg-tageg = pelix-druix-holius-briael-zorwyn-frawyn-fraox-norok-drueth-aldiel

**Ticket: Snapshot diffs flaky for plugin panels**

Hey plugin folks — snapshots of Glintkit panel components keep failing on CI because timestamps render into the DOM. Freeze the clock in your test setup and regenerate baselines. We'll add a built-in shim next release. Regenerate against the build whose token is below.

pipeline stamp: htk9_ce63042d9